Mold Cleanup Seattle

Mold is a type of fungus, it is Nature’s Recycler, decomposing dead organic material
  • Mold is a good thing… outside!
Mold needs TWO ingredients to initiate and propagate
  • A constant water supply AND a food source
  • Your wood dresser is a food source, but no water so no mold!
  • Your kitchen sink is always wet, but it is not organic, so no mold!
Estimated over 100k species of mold worldwide; many colors 
  • Penicillium, Aspergillus, Cladosporium, Chaetomium, Stachybotrys
  • Only a handful are mycotoxins, toxic substances produced by a fungus
Mold is microscopic, always in the air, traveling as spores
  • Spores are the reproductive method for all types of mold

Restoration companies are concerned about mold in three spaces

  • Attic Space, Living Space, Crawlspace

Attic Mold

#1 Reason for Attic Mold – Greater than 90% of attic mold Seattle residents can face is caused by inadequate ventilation alone. Other common reasons include roof leaks around skylights and vents, tree branch damage during storms, or simply the age of your roofing materials. By identifying these issues early, Seattle homeowners can prevent costly mold growth and protect their property’s long-term health and value.”

    • Peaked roofs have more mold growth on north facing side – never gets warmed up in winter months due to Seattle latitude.

Living Space Mold

#1 Reason for mold – relative humidity sustained above 60%.

  • Shower wall affected (organic), shower tile and shower head not affected (inorganic).
  • Unoccupied home– hot water heater pinhole leak, hot moist air raises relative humidity.
  • Inside a closet, only surface damage and can be cleaned and disinfected.
  • Wood window seal – single pane glass, condensation, constant water supply, both mold ingredients. Best to have double-pane vinyl framed windows.
  • Ceiling mold – if leak from above, material has to be removed and area disinfected.
  • Inside Chemistry – quats, or essential oil Thymol (doesn’t even have a warning label, can drink it).

Crawlspace Mold

#1 Reason for Mold – Leak in the crawlspace from pressurized pipes (freshwater lines).

  • Flooded or heavily water affected crawlspaces often have heavy wet, slimy mold on the joists and flooring ceiling.
  • We first remove the batt insulation, then chemically treat the wood, then fog the area, then set drying equipment.
  • If the area is not water affected but has surface mold because of higher RH (common in large areas), we remove the insulation, surface treat the wood, replace the same insulation.

Roof Leaks

Roof leaks are a common cause of mold contamination in both residential and commercial properties. When water infiltrates through damaged shingles or flashing, it often seeps into dark, undisturbed spaces like attics, insulation, or wall cavities. These areas provide ideal conditions for mold growth. If undetected, this hidden moisture can lead to severe mold infestations that compromise indoor air quality and weaken building materials. Excessive Humidity

Humidity levels above 60% can quickly lead to mold growth in vulnerable areas like bathrooms, laundry rooms, and poorly ventilated basements. In these environments, moisture doesn’t evaporate properly, allowing mold to take hold. A Washington State Certified Mold Inspector is required to identify mold

  • Contractors and home inspectors use the term “possible microbial growth”

No certification requirements for performing mold remediation in Washington State

  • IICRC offers mold remediation certification, we are an IICRC certified company

Two principal test methods

  • Air sampling is the most common – determines ambient mold levels vs. outside levels
  • Tape lift (surface) identifies mold on a surface, but does not indicate indoor air quality
